Just a simple card today which I made for a neighbour whose dog died.


Emboss the front of an ice blue pearlescent card blank (from Anna Marie Designs) using the 'Make a Wish' embossing folder by Die'sire.

Cut a tag shape from shrink plastic and punch a hole in it. Edge with pale blue pearlescent chalk and stamp the greeting in black Stazon ink - I used 'Written Greetings' from Stamps Away.

Heat with your heat gun to shrink it and then tie pale blue organza ribbon through the hole.
Attach to the card with silicon glue.
